QUARTERLY PLANNING NOTE — Gravenholt Office Closure

Heads up, everyone: we've decided to close the Gravenholt office at the end of Q2. It's been running at about a third capacity since the Hallow project wrapped, and the lease renewal numbers just don't work. The six remaining staff will move to remote or transfer to Ashmere. Please keep this quiet until Denna briefs the team directly. For planning purposes, here is the sensitive bit:

management briefing: The southern region missed its Oliox quota by 51.7 percent last quarter. Juldorek Freight plans to raise the Silath list price by 49.7 percent in January. The board signed off on a budget of $388.0 million for Project Casok. The renewal with Fradorix Foods closes at $53.0 million a year, 49.8 percent below the last contract.

TICKET-4182: The Brimvault secrets store locked itself after three failed unseal attempts during cold starts of the Lanternjet serverless handlers. Reviewer note: the warm-up probe fires before the vault client initializes, triggering spurious auth failures. Fix is in the linked branch. To unseal the staging vault manually, use the recovery passphrase below.

unlock words, yawig-kagef: gordor-holvan-ulaael-pramir-ulaiel-tamdor

Subject: Autocomplete widget — staging access

Hi,

Welcome aboard. The Plottanix address autocomplete widget is live on our staging sandbox. Embed the script tag per the integration doc, then verify suggestions fire after three keystrokes. Known quirks: rural routes sometimes rank below city matches, and the dropdown clips inside scrollable modals — both are on our board. Don't test against production; rate limits there are strict. Requests to the staging suggestion endpoint must carry the bearer token below.

Thanks,
Marisol

session JWT of tadup-kaguf = eyJhbGciOiJIUzI1NiIsInR5cCI6IkpXVCJ9.eyJzdWIiOiItNz4V3In0.KrZCeqpk